I.OBJECTIVES
A. Content Standards The learner demonstrates understanding sports in optimizing one’s health as a habit; as requisite for PA performance, and as a
career opportunity.

B. Performance Standards The learner leads sports events with proficiency and confidence resulting in independent pursuit and in influencing others
positively.

C. Learning Competencies / Objectives The learner:


Discusses the nature of the different sports activities. (PE11FH-IIa-18)

II.CONTENT Sports: An Introduction

III. PROCEDURES
Before the Lesson
A. Reviewing previous lesson or presenting the new What are the different sports that you have participated?
lesson
B. Establishing a purpose for the lesson Identify the nature and background of different sports.
Determine the types of sports participation.

C. Presenting examples / instances of the new lesson Brainstorming: Popular Sports Icon

During the Lesson


D. Discussing new concepts and practicing new skills List down the different kinds of sports and identify if it is individual, dual or team sports.
#1
E. Discussing new concepts and practicing new skills What is the difference among individual, dual or team sports?
#2 What does one need to know in playing sports?

F. Developing Mastery Group Dynamics


G1 – Table Tennis G3 - Volleyball
G2 – Badminton G4 - Basketball
G. Finding practical applications of concepts & skills in Sports Participation:
daily living List down the sports and describe your participation
After the Lesson
H. Making generalizations & abstractions about the Sports is an activity that requires physical actions and skills where individuals or teams compete under a set of rules. In
lesson whichever sports, the benefits of participating in a physical activity is the most significant.

I. Evaluating Learning Paper and Pencil Test


(Pls. see test notebook)
J. Additional activities for application or remediation Choose one sport and create a brochure for it. Topics that should be included are the following:
a. Court dimensions
b. Equipment
c. Basic Skills
d. Rules of the game
e. How to Officiate the sports
